Education Policy: Arkansas’ 2026-27 school changes put literacy and graduation requirements in the spotlight, including third-grade repeat rules for students who miss state reading standards and a new 75-hour community service requirement for most high schoolers. Local Sports & Community: Pottsville’s volleyball program gets a hometown boost as Southside alum Kacie Stabler enters her fourth season as head coach. Higher Ed & Health: Arkansas State University held a white coat ceremony for its inaugural veterinary medicine class, marking a major milestone for Jonesboro-area training. Public Safety: A man’s reported plan to jump from the Broadway Bridge in North Little Rock led to a brief closure and a rescue response. Immigration & Enforcement: ICE says the Forest Service requested cooperation in a Wilson Creek operation, renewing questions about how federal immigration enforcement intersects with public lands. Arts & Culture: The Momentary drops the full lineup for Momentous, a two-day electronic music and arts festival celebrating Arkansas Music Week. Arts & Community Events: Arkansas State University–Mountain Home expands the Mountain Home Art Walk with a first national call for entry for visiting artists. Lifestyle & Family: A “class plant” trend makes the case for potted greenery in classrooms, linking it to calmer learning and better focus. Health & Wellness: Local dental and medical profiles highlight new tech and care approaches, from 3D dental printing to Parkinson’s-focused outreach at UAMS.
